Markkleeberger Lake is a region in the Leipzig New Lakeland, transformed from a former open-pit lignite mine into a vibrant recreational area. The landscape features clear lake waters, diverse shorelines with meadows and forests, and well-developed infrastructure. Its mostly flat, well-maintained paths make it suitable for several sports like touring cycling, hiking, jogging, road cycling, and more. The area offers a blend of natural features and insights into its geological past.

Markkleeberger Lake offers a variety of outdoor activities, including Touring cycling, Hiking, Jogging, and Road cycling. The region features well-maintained, mostly flat paths suitable for various fitness levels. Water sports such as sailing, diving, and stand-up paddling are also available.
The region offers an extensive network of mostly flat, asphalted paths for cycling. A popular option is the circular path around Markkleeberger Lake itself. Cyclists can also connect to neighboring lakes for longer tours, such as the 20-mile (32.7 km) loop connecting Markkleeberger Lake and Störmthaler Lake.
Yes, a popular circular path approximately 5.7 to 5.8 miles (9.2 to 9.34 km) long encircles Markkleeberger Lake. This path is well-maintained, asphalted, and offers continuous views of the water. More information can be found in the guide Cycling around Markkleeberger Lake.

Markkleeberger Lake offers diverse routes for hiking and jogging. The main circular path around the lake is approximately 5.6 to 6.4 miles (9 to 10.3 km) long. The "Geological Time Stairs loop" (around 5.2 miles / 8.4 km) and the 9.3-mile (15 km) "GEOPFAD" offer insights into the region's history. Find more options in Hiking around Markkleeberger Lake.

Key attractions include the clear lake waters and beaches like Auenhain and Wachau. The Kanupark Markkleeberg offers whitewater rafting and kayaking. The "GEOPFAD" provides insights into the region's geological past and transformation from a mining landscape.
